Reactive Dyes
CLASS: BI-FUNCTIONAL / MONOFor cotton, viscose and cotton-blend fabrics, formulated for high fixation rates and consistent shade repeatability.
COTTON & VISCOSEDisperse Dyes
CLASS: HIGH-TEMP / CARRIERFine-particle disperse dyes for polyester and polyester-blend fabrics, built for even exhaustion in HT dyeing.
POLYESTERVat Dyes
CLASS: VAT / SOLUBILISEDHigh wash and light-fastness dyes for denim, workwear and export-grade woven fabric.
DENIM & WOVENPigment Pastes
CLASS: AQUEOUS DISPERSIONReady-to-use pigment pastes for pigment dyeing and printing, matched to standard shade cards on request.
PRINTINGSofteners & Fixing Agents
CLASS: CATIONIC / SILICONEHand-feel softeners and colour-fixing agents that improve wash fastness without shade change.
FINISHINGSizing & Auxiliary Chemicals
CLASS: STARCH / PVA BLENDWarp sizing agents, wetting agents and levelling chemicals used across the pre-treatment process.
WEAVING PREPEvery batch is tested before it ships.
Our in-house lab checks colour strength, fastness and reproducibility against reference standards on every production run.
Raw material testing
Incoming intermediates are checked for purity before they enter production.
Colour strength matching
Spectrophotometer readings confirm each batch matches the approved shade standard.
Fastness testing
Wash, rub and light fastness are verified against AATCC and ISO reference methods.
Certificate of Analysis
Every dispatched batch ships with a CoA and, on request, an SDS for the shipment.
